Output 6d58a4500314efd3dcce9d738177632304bb6faaba1ffc36f2a13b02f4ac442a:42

value
83950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d41040fe1d7ca6c64be9eef841803a00f10364 OP_EQUAL
address
3EoWbQTQskTirbpBmxqqhMnHLdqegt8afv
transaction
6d58a4500314efd3dcce9d738177632304bb6faaba1ffc36f2a13b02f4ac442a
confirmations
283435
spent
true